IP查询
查询
你查询的IP:[116.4.62.253] 地理位置:中国–广东–东莞
最新查询
219.242.35.227
203.95.77.148
122.224.7.239
118.212.84.211
210.72.201.65
222.240.216.251
202.127.114.96
222.168.190.169
118.212.58.200
116.4.62.253
203.184.80.34
116.4.150.8
118.84.7.51
203.119.32.243
202.14.88.209
220.192.153.71
221.200.165.197
117.22.226.203
210.22.221.213
118.144.199.46
210.15.26.163
58.32.139.244
210.185.192.84
210.2.152.95
159.226.237.113
116.89.144.242
202.70.227.190
119.27.160.239
202.130.224.56
116.60.229.13
124.88.27.19